Output 38703525055b93fedcc645a837c890ae3f4e9891892057f5d9168b84d1ebd129:1

value
1617699
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e99da9172de489f3b0b00107b8d7fc493afa0845 OP_EQUALVERIFY OP_CHECKSIG
address
1NJFK9AXTnf4YSmx1VwV1pvvx29RHyNWTx
transaction
38703525055b93fedcc645a837c890ae3f4e9891892057f5d9168b84d1ebd129
spent
true